Re: the Lexweave string-extraction script. Your change scans every locale file on each run, which is why CI times doubled. Cache the parse tree keyed on file hash and only re-extract dirty modules. Also, the regex for placeholder tokens is greedy and swallows adjacent markup — switch to the tokenizer in `lexweave.scan`. I bumped the worker pool and batch limits so the cache warm-up doesn't starve the queue. The values I landed on after profiling are below.

constants for bagag-fawip:
BUDGETS = {
    "wenius": 400,
    "brieth": 224,
    "rusath": 783,
    "eliys": 187,
    "aldax": 737,
    "ralion": 818,
    "istius": 153,
}

Hey folks — handing off LiftPath release duties to Mara while I'm out. The elevator-dispatch simulator ships Thursdays; build 4.2 is staged and the scenario packs are frozen. Only gotcha: the dispatch-core artifact won't promote unless it's signed before the smoke suite kicks off, so do that first, not after. Everything else is in the runbook on the Ostermill wiki. Mara, you'll need the deploy key to push to the release channel, so pasting it here for the sync notes.

deploy key for tawip-bawig: bky13_1zSxDtVxnNkjh

## Tuning the Bloom Filter

Pellwick places a bloom filter in front of the Kestrelstore lookup path to avoid disk reads for absent keys. The false-positive rate trades memory against wasted reads: lowering it grows the bit array and hash count, which raises CPU cost per probe. Start from the defaults, measure miss traffic in staging, and adjust only one parameter at a time. The default constants are shown below.

tuning constants:
QUOTAS = {
    "druwyn": 5,
    "holix": 5,
    "zorath": 5,
    "holwyn": 10,
}

Handover — Veldane Components, inventory write-down. Board copy. Q3 count at the Brenmark warehouse confirmed 14% obsolescence in the Korvex line; write-down of 2.1M approved by audit committee. Residual stock to be liquidated by year-end. Marit Solberg assumes responsibility for the disposal plan from this date. No further adjustments expected this quarter. The related strategic rationale is summarised in the note below.

board note of bahaf-kahif: Gross margin on Wenael came in at 10 percent against a plan of 15 percent. Only 7 of the 120 pilot accounts renewed Wenael, so a churn review is set for July 1.